Photo: Republican Club of North & East Fort Myers A Black Trump supporter in Florida is suing a Republican group, claiming he was called a “slave.” According to NBC 2, Carl Baxter, a well-known Trumper from Lee County and president of the Republican Club of North and East Fort Myers, filed a lawsuit against Americans … Continued
